Initiative will be a testing ground for new ways of teaching and learning, Commission says
The European Commission says it will raise research and education standards by helping institutions trailblaze teaching methods such as ‘micro-credentials’ and adult-learning programmes.
“Europe is ready for bold educational innovation”, Themis Christophidou (pictured), the Commission’s director-general for education, told an event on the European Universities Initiative (EUI), the EU’s scheme to promote cross-border cooperation via joint programmes and mobility schemes.
